Omega Sports Local Area Guide
Welcome to Omega Sports in Greensboro, North Carolina, a premier destination for sports enthusiasts and athletes. This guide is designed to help visitors, teams, and families navigate the area, plan their schedules, and make the most of their time around Omega Sports. Discover convenient lodging, dining options, and local attractions to enhance your visit, ensuring a smooth and enjoyable experience from arrival to departure.
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Omega Sports (Greensboro, NC)
Omega Sports is situated in Greensboro, North Carolina, a city known for its rich history and vibrant community spirit. Located at 2431 Battleground Avenue, it benefits from a central position within the Piedmont Triad region, offering good accessibility from major thoroughfares. Interstate 40 and Business 40 are nearby, providing convenient links to the surrounding areas and connecting to US-29 and US-70 for broader reach. Greensboro is served by the Piedmont Triad International Airport (GSO), approximately a 20-minute drive away, making it accessible for travelers. Public transportation options are available within the city, though most visitors find personal vehicles or rideshares most efficient for reaching Omega Sports and exploring the vicinity. Planning your arrival to account for local traffic patterns, especially during peak hours or around scheduled events at the complex, is advisable for a stress-free experience.

Greensboro Science Center
The Greensboro Science Center is a multi-faceted attraction featuring an aquarium, a museum of natural sciences, and a zoo. It offers interactive exhibits and live animal encounters, making it an engaging destination for all ages. The aquarium showcases marine life from various ecosystems, while the museum covers dinosaurs, geology, and local wildlife. The zoo area provides a chance to see a diverse range of animals, and the planetarium offers educational shows about space. It's an excellent choice for educational fun, especially on days with less favorable weather.
4301 Lawndale Dr · 3.5 miInternational Civil Rights Center & Museum
Located in downtown Greensboro, the International Civil Rights Center & Museum is housed in the historic F.W. Woolworth building, the site of the 1960 lunch counter sit-ins. The museum preserves the history of the nonviolent civil rights movement and its impact. Visitors can take guided tours that recount the events of the sit-ins and discuss the broader struggle for civil rights in America. It offers a powerful and educational experience, providing historical context and fostering reflection on social justice issues.

Weather & Seasons at Omega Sports
- Winter: Winter in Greensboro typically brings cool to cold temperatures, with average highs in the 40s and 50s Fahrenheit. You’ll want to pack layers, including sweaters, jackets, and possibly gloves and a hat for colder days. Outdoor events might be brief, and participants should prepare for potentially damp conditions, as rain is more common than snow. The ground can be soft after precipitation, so footwear that can handle mud or wet surfaces is advisable.
- Spring & early summer: Spring and early summer offer some of the most pleasant weather for sports. Temperatures gradually warm from the 60s to the 70s and low 80s Fahrenheit. Light jackets or long-sleeved shirts are useful for cooler mornings or evenings, while shorts and t-shirts are comfortable during the day. It’s wise to pack sunscreen and a hat, as sunny days can be warm, and occasional spring showers can occur, requiring light rain gear.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er, from July through August, is typically the hottest period, with daytime temperatures frequently reaching into the 80s and 90s Fahrenheit, often accompanied by high humidity. Lightweight, breathable clothing like cotton or moisture-wicking fabrics is essential. Staying hydrated is critical, so carry plenty of water. Sunscreen, hats, and sunglasses are non-negotiable for anyone spending extended time outdoors. Afternoon thunderstorms are also common.
- Fall season: Fall brings crisp air and comfortable temperatures, generally ranging from the 50s to the 70s Fahrenheit, making it a prime season for outdoor sports. This period is ideal for wearing layers, such as long-sleeved shirts, light sweaters, and jackets. While the weather is usually stable, occasional cool fronts can bring chillier days or breezy conditions, so it’s good to be prepared. Fall colors add a scenic backdrop to the area.
- Rain & snow: Rain is possible year-round in Greensboro but is more frequent in spring and late fall. Snowfall is less common and usually light, typically occurring in January and February. During rainy periods, waterproof outerwear and umbrellas are recommended for comfort and to protect gear. If snow does fall, it can temporarily impact outdoor activities, potentially leading to delays or cancellations, and roads may become slick. Checking event status is crucial during inclement weather.
